Read the final book in the #1 New York Times bestselling Reckoners series by worldwide bestselling author Brandon Sanderson!     When Calamity lit up the sky, the Epics were born. David’s fate has been tied to their villainy ever since that historic night. Steelheart killed his father. Firefight stole his heart. And now Regalia has turned Prof, his closest ally, into a dangerous enemy.    David knew Prof’s secret, and kept it even when Prof struggled to control the effects of his Epic powers. But facing Obliteration in Babilar was too much. Once the Reckoners’ leader, Prof has now embraced his Epic destiny. He’s disappeared into those murky shadows of menace Epics are infamous for the world over, and everyone knows there’s no turning back. . . .   But everyone is wrong. Redemption is possible for Epics—Megan proved it. They’re not lost. Not completely. And David is just about crazy enough to face down the most powerful High Epic of all to get his friend back. Many say that this is the weakest book of the Reconkers series, but I don’t agree. The first book was best, the second was the weakest, this landed somewhere in the middle. If you don’t agree though let me just say that being the WEAKEST novel doesn’t nessacarily mean it is the worst one of the series. This story was built on action, characters and setting. It was not at all a plot-driven story, rather it was the investment I had in the characters that kept me reading. The reason this book was the weakest of the series (I call it finale syndrome) was because it relied on plot when the other books didn’t. Instead of blissfully fluffing together a fast-paced adventure, we needed logical closure, and that’s where Calamity fell flat. The plot was always a bit shaky, and it was most noticeable in this book. It was always VERY far fetched - but hey that’s why we sci-fi and fantasy lovers read things like that don’t we? Anyway, it had to end somehow, and although the ending was confusing and stark in contrast to the rest of the series (easy to follow and fun) this required investment in the actual plot. I thought the ending was bizarre because it opened up the door for future books, or did it? It’s hard to tell and it didn’t give us complete resolution. The book was good, very Good in fact, but because it suffered such a bad case of Finale Syndrome, it can only get four stars in my opinion.

Like most great series I’ve read, I’m sad to see that the Reckoners series is over. Brandon Sanderson did not disappoint with the conclusion to the series, Calamity. In it, we find David, Megan and who’s left of the Reckoners team banding together to try to bring Prof back from the darkness of having embraced becoming an Epic. Megan did it (or is trying), so why can’t they do it for Prof, too? After they accomplish that plan, next they hope to destroy Calamity. But it is easier said than done, and more Epics and danger are ready to stand in their way.I’ve been told that the first book is being optioned for a movie, and I could not be more excited. Reading this series is akin to watching a Marvel movie. It has super-villains pitted against the heroes/Reckoners, so a lot of fighting and action occurring, with displays of supernatural abilities. We also have our main character, David, who is strong, smart, and determined… but also a bit silly and naïve. He provides much needed humor to what can be dark circumstances. There’s also a lot of camaraderie amongst the Reckoners, and chemistry between David and Megan. To me, everything comes together in just great storytelling. I would, and have, recommend this series to people who enjoy YA, action, sci-fi/fantasy, and superheroes with a twist.

The twists in this novel were inspired and kept me hooked until the very end. My only complaint is that I expected more fromBrandon Sanderson in regards to his "magic system." In his other novels like Mistborn his magic systems usually make logical sense and follow a pre-established set of guidelines. However, the longer this series goes on it seems like the powers, technology, and characters get a bit more thrown together. It seems like Sanderson didn't take the time to develop his characters and world building that are trademark Sanderson. This series seems to merely to be the product of a dinner conversation where one person asked the other "what would the world be like if Superman were a villain?"TLDR; Solid novel. Substandard world building from Brandon Sanderson.

"Calamity" is the third book in "The Reckoners" series, following "Steelheart" and "Firefight". "The Reckoners" series postulates an Earth like our own that has been overshadowed by an astronomical phenomenon that people have called "Calamity". The effect of this is that certain humans have developed super-powers. Unfortunately, this has not turned them into the Justice League. Just the opposite. They've taken over the planet, dividing it into fiefdoms, held according to how powerful their super-power is. And, they rule by fear and ruthlessness. The Reckoners are the human sixth column against the super-beings.This series has well-developed characters and an intricate plot. It has more twists than a pretzel, and it is sometimes hard to figure out who the bad guys are. It is a delightful read, but really needs to be read in order. If this is the first book you have encountered in "The Reckoners" series, look up "Steelheart" and purchase it first.Given that, I highly recommend this book. It is not suitable for young readers due to violence, but I'd consider letting teens over 14 years old read it.
